Axfr ixfr commands for mac

Use dig to download zone data zone data can downloaded programmatically from your managed dns account using binds dig tool. How to install a ftp client from the command line on mac. If i change the domain to a nonexistent one, i do see an entry in the dns server logs in event viewer, so i know the queries are hitting the dns server fine. By default dig will try to use tcp for all axfr and ixfr operations, but. Bind 8 ixfr configuration configuring ixfr in bind 8 is fairly straightforward.

A tcpsoa axfr client, such as namedxfer or axfrget or dig axfr, actually works as follows. Axfr is listed in the worlds largest and most authoritative dictionary database of. The first and the last rr of the response is the soa record of the zone. Use dns policy for geolocation based traffic management with.

Axfr is listed in the worlds largest and most authoritative dictionary database of abbreviations and acronyms. Ipconfig mac just like you you can open command prompt in windows and hit ipconfig to get your local lanwlan ip address, you have the same option on a mac in os x with the command ifconfig. Under service defaults, select defaults enabled and enter your ip address in the host 1. Incremental transfer ixfr as proposed is a more efficient mechanism, as it transfers only the changed portions of a zone. Bernstein internet publication djbdns how to answer tcp queries here is how to configure your dns server to answer tcp queries. If wait is less than one, the wait interval is set to. Since usrsbin exists in the default path, you can access the command. How the axfr protocol works i wrote this page to explain exactly how the axfr protocol works, so that axfr implementors can avoid interoperability problems. Zone transfers axfr requests have the purpose to replicate dns databases across a set of dns servers.

Ok i add allowupdate now bhordupur mar 16 16 at 14. But now i can dig sec t axfr and dig sec t axfr from the machine 1 and it is transfering the zone file but machine two can dig but can not transfer the zone file. You have several hosting servers, and you have not grown. Zone transfer comes in two flavors, full opcode axfr and incremental ixfr. It can be used from linux or mac osx operating systems and normally it is used. Therefore the zone transfers are usually only allowed for the ip addresses of secondary slave name servers. Axfr stands for all zone transfer computer infrastructure suggest new definition this definition appears frequently and is found in the following acronym finder categories. Dyn supports zone transfers via axfrfull or ixfrincremental zone transfers. Unlike normal dns queries that require the user to know some dns information ahead of time, axfr queries reveal resource records including subdomain names 1.

A zone transfer can be requested by specifying a axfr. Axfr is a protocol for zone transfers for replication of dns data across multiple dns servers. Global anycast dns providers which accept axfrixfr. Dont forget to enable slavesupport by saying slaveyes in nf or powerdns server will not poll master nameservers for soa changes or accept notifys from them. Use dns policy for geolocation based traffic management. Some of these set or reset flag bits in the query header, some determine which sections of the answer get printed, and others determine the timeout and retry strategies. You will need the public ip address of the server or pc where you intend to use dig.

These instructions assume that you are already running tinydns as a dns server. Diagnose mac networking problems with these three commands. Feb 01, 2015 powerdns authoritative, powerdns recursor, dnsdist powerdnspdns. Apr 07, 2020 cisco asa series command reference, i r commands. Ibm has released a security advisory and fixes to address the isc bind tsig authentication axfr requests bypass vulnerability. If you can find another mac running macos or os x, i suppose you could copy ftp from this machine to your mac. Yes, i swap the configuration file and they are declared properly. If you followed the instructions for upgrading from bind, youre already answering tcp queries, so. It is one of the many mechanisms available for administrators to replicate dns databases across a set of dns servers a zone transfer uses the transmission control protocol tcp for transport, and takes the form of a clientserver transaction. The zone being served is held by named in its working memory, and periodically written out to disk as a backup. A nonaxfr dns client tries all queries through udp first. When you need to get information about a particular network interface, add the option ls followed by the name of the network interface.

Axfr stands for all zone transfer computer infrastructure suggest new definition. Although dig is normally used with commandline arguments, it also has a. This example assumes you are using bind for your primary nameserver. You do not have to have dns to request a zone transfer. Sometimes and usually unexpectedly, a zone update that would normally be incremental ixfr, instead takes place as a full zone transfer. Mar 14, 2016 extend azure dns to support zone transfers so it can be used as seconday dns if azure dns supported zone transfers, then if could be used both as a reliable secondary dns service, or as an external proxy service for ad splitbrain, or onpremise hosted dns configurations. To do this you can use the ip command with the option s and then specify the network device.

The parameter axfr is the one that allows the zone transfer of said dns, since it is used to synchronize and to update data of the zone when changes occurred. The reason the same retrieval could make sense is that the reason for the rejection could be rooted in an implementation detail of one axfr. If enabled, the zone is signed after every axfrixfr transfer from master, so that. Hp has released a security bulletin and updated software to address the isc bind tsig authentication axfr requests bypass vulnerability. He feels he was wrongly terminated and wants to hack into his former companys network. In master mode powerdns server will send notifys to all nameservers that are listed as ns records in the zone if it is a master zone.

If you have sierra installed and are using either of these commands, you will need to make a copy before upgrading to high sierra. What axfr does axfr is a mechanism for replicating dns data across dns servers. When an incremental zone transfer ixfr is required, type is set to ixfrn. To delegate the domain, many registrars require the domain zone to be served by at least two name servers residing in different ip subnets.

Domains which use secondary dns are scheduled to be added to the secondary dns services no earlier than 2 hours after you enter the data into the system. Axfr ixfr can be specified when testing the zone transfer with the dig command. Answer as osx is based on unix you need to type in the following command from a terminal prompt ifconfig a this has been tested on. Response format if incremental zone transfer is not available, the entire zone is returned. Nmap scan and use the defined dns server in the arguments. For a cluster in individual interface mode see the cluster interfacemode command, or for a management interface in any cluster interface mode, sets a pool of mac addresses to be used for a given interface on each cluster member. First, you need an options substatement called maintainixfrbase on your master name server that tells it to maintain ixfr log files for all zones even those the name server is a slave for, since those in turn may have slaves that want ixfrs options directory varnamed. Please see your current dns providers documentation for whether they support these protocols. Although the transfer can be done via axfr, it is also possible to do it incrementally, then called ixfr when the request is executed the transfer of the entire zone is obtained. Powerdns authoritative, powerdns recursor, dnsdist powerdnspdns. Initiating an axfr zonetransfer request from a secondary server is as simple as using the following dig commands, where zonetransfer.

Global anycast dns providers which accept axfr ixfr am evaluating global anycast dns providers which can operate as slaves via the standard axfr ixfr protocol so we can manage via hidden master. You purchased a domain name from a domain registrar. A dig utility allows you to make dig commands to a server. Mydns seems to have fixed the bug in cvs or was is svn. Dig is native to osx and linux systems, and can be accessed via terminal. Because of this, the secondary servers remain synchronized with the primary server. To dump all available records, assuming zone transfers are enabled, issue the following commands.

Log into your managed dns account overview page and click the edit button beside the external nameservers under your customer account info 3. This definition appears frequently and is found in the following acronym finder categories. This is used for querying dns name servers and is particularly useful for troubleshooting or just for educational services as a demonstration of how servers work. Incremental zone transfer ixfr dns and bind, 4th edition. Ispconfig3 mydnsng master axfr zone transfer to bind9. Looking for online definition of axfr or what axfr stands for. Rfc 5936 dns zone transfer protocol axfr june 2010 if an axfr client rejects data obtained in an axfr session, it should remember the serial number and may attempt to retrieve the same zone version again. Dns zone transfer, also sometimes known by the inducing dns query type axfr, is a type of dns transaction. Introduction the domain name system standard facilities for maintaining coherent servers for a zone consist of three elements. You can issue a zone transfer request using the nslookup client which is a standard part of unix, nt, windows 2000 and xp. Rfc 1995 incremental zone transfer in dns august 1996 4. Note that most dns servers do not need to answer tcp queries. The dns server im querying is not showing anything in its logs for this query. Secondary servers make an incremental zone transfer request ixfr.

Preface there are several reasons why you might need at least two dns servers for serving your sites. Apr, 2015 axfr is a protocol for zone transfers for replication of dns data across multiple dns servers. Open terminal or bind and enter this command, replacing with your. A zone transfer uses the transmission control protocol tcp for transport, and takes the form of a clientserver. You have several hosting servers, and you have not grown enough to use the products like ppa or pa. Because a zone transfer is a single query, it could be used by an adversary to efficiently obtain dns data.

Dns zone transfer, also sometimes known by its most common opcode mnemonic axfr, is a type of dns transaction. Cisco asa series command reference, i r commands mac. This command should also work for other versions of osx please note. Rfc 5936 dns zone transfer protocol axfr june 2010 1. Mac os x comes with a very convenient tool called networksetup that makes it relatively easy to view or change network settings from the command line. Authoritative transfer axfr is defined in domain names concepts and facilities referred to in this document as rfc 1034 and domain names implementation and specification.

Am evaluating global anycast dns providers which can operate as slaves via the standard axfrixfr protocol so we can manage via hidden master. If a query type of ixfr is chosen the starting serial number can be specified by appending an equal followed by the starting serial number e. I wrote this page to explain exactly how the axfr protocol works, so that. Bsd and mac os ship with a sufficiently recent resolver. Under service defaults, select defaults enabled and enter your ip address in the host 1 field. If it would be firewalls issue, i wouldnt see in my computer log files that there such a request has been made.

Axfr is a mechanism for replicating dns data across dns servers. The update command will check for new versions of all secondary zones. Reverse lookups mapping addresses to names are simplified by the x option. It is one of the many mechanisms available for administrators to employ for replicating the databases containing the dns data across a set of dns servers. Since simon remembers some of the server names, he attempts to run the axfr and ixfr commands using dig. Dyn and akamai fastdns both support axfr ixfr and have a very good global footprint for their anycast network. Using a larger value may yield more zone transfers but can dramatically increase the time needed to test all one million domains. Extend azure dns to support zone transfers so it can be used as seconday dns if azure dns supported zone transfers, then if could be used both as a reliable secondary dns service, or as an external proxy service for ad splitbrain.

Keep in mind that this has very little to do with web applications, the above has to do with dns. When you pass a domain name to the dig command, by default it displays the a record the ipaddress of the site that is queried as shown below. This provides enough time to configure your primary dns servers to allow axfrixfr transfers to our secondary name servers. The ip command can also be used to show the statistics of the various network interfaces.

The time to wait for a reply can be controlled through the w and w options. This article explains 10 examples on how to use dig command. It is one of the many mechanisms available for administrators to replicate dns databases across a set of dns servers. When needed, the primary servers send notifications to the secondary servers about zone updates. If it would be firewalls issue, i wouldnt see in my computer log files that there such a. When the master name server receives an incremental zone transfer request, it looks for the record of the. Configuring your current provider to allow zone transfers learn more about dns zones in order for dyns managed dns to transfer your zone data to our system, you will need to configure your primary dns server to allow zone transfers to the dyn provisioning servers shown in the table below. Extend azure dns to support zone transfers so it can be used. The worlds most comprehensive professionally edited abbreviations and acronyms database all trademarksservice marks referenced on this site are properties of their respective owners. Ispconfig3 mydnsng master axfr zone transfer to bind9 slave. Dns zone transfer axfr requests may leak domain information.

Oct 23, 20 preface there are several reasons why you might need at least two dns servers for serving your sites. In this document, a secondary name server which requests ixfr is called an ixfr client and a primary or secondary name server which responds to the request is called an ixfr server. The ifconfig command also enables assigning a specific ip address to a specific network interface. But their decision not to release a bugfix version is not very responsible, all the more so as their last build is from march 2009. Following is an example of how you can use dns policy in a primarysecondary deployment to achieve traffic redirection on the basis of the physical location of the client that performs a dns query.

The incremental zone transfer will contain the changes made to the zone since the serial number in the zones soa record was n. For example, the following command assigns a lan ip address of 192. Mar 26, 2020 primarysecondary geolocation based traffic management example. An incremental zone transfer request has a query type of ixfr instead of axfr the type of query that initiates a full zone transfer, and it contains the slaves current soa record from the zone in the authority section of the message. To dump the dns records from your current domain, lets says, its. I heard that it is possible to test for zone transfer attacks on a web application using host and dig commands in. Primarysecondary geolocation based traffic management example. In leopard, the command is readily available at usrsbinnetworksetup. This page describes the powerdns server axfr functionality and how to configure it. First, we need to get the list of dns servers for the domain. The secondary zones make a full zone transfer request axfr and receive the copy of the zone. This provides enough time to configure your primary dns servers to allow axfr ixfr transfers to our secondary name servers. Dig uses the axfr response to retrieve your zone information. Extend azure dns to support zone transfers so it can be.

Vendor announcements, fixed software, and affected products. Some of these set or reset flag bits in the query header, some determine which sections of the answer get printed, and. An incremental dnz zone transfer will transfer all of the records since a given. Rfc 5936 dns zone transfer protocol axfr june 2010 an implementation of an axfr server may permit configuring, on a per axfr client basis, the necessity to revert to a single resource record per message.

783 804 1527 599 302 757 579 1134 1524 963 919 714 1081 435 1138 663 146 69 911 313 798 1223 1313 1424 910 1202 1416 45 68 80 98 1252 474 1227 515 138 71 387 838